[–] the_artic_one@programming.dev 1 points 6 days ago* (last edited 6 days ago) (1 children)

Most of the other ink caps (everything besides the shaggy ones with a ring) got moved out of Coprinus because they're actually in a completely different family (Psathyrellaceae). These are Coprinellus.
